HoT, Revan, Exile, Windu, and Dooku run a gauntlet

Hey everyone! Been lurking here for about five years now, finally made an account.

Team is healed and restored after each round. They've had a month's worth of prep to plan each fight and figure out a way to use each other's strengths in a coordinated fashion.

Revan is the team's lead strategist and has access to dossiers detailing the general strengths and weaknesses of each opponent.

The team:

End of class story Hero of Tython.
End of Kotor Revan.
End of Kotor II Exile.
ROTS Windu.
ROTS Dooku.

All five are *extremely* determined to win.

Fight takes place on the plains of Dantooine. All opponents are at their peak unless otherwise specified.

Warmup : Darth Bandon, Savage Opress, Kyle Katarn, and Baris Ofee.

1. ROTS Kenobi, ROTS Vader, and three highly experienced Magna Guards.
2. Exar Kun, Ulic, Starforge Amped Darth Malak, and Darkside Bastila
3. Yoda, ROTS Sidious, ESB Vader, and Darth Maul
4. DE Luke, Darth Plageuis, and Vitiate.
5. Zone Anakin, Darth Caedus, and DE Sidious
6. The Son (assume he has as much power as he does on Mortis)

Where do they struggle? Where do they fall? Does Revan's leadership along with the prep time make any difference?

I feel Windu's Vapaad amp would allow him to reach the Sidious levels again in round 3, given the "Extremely determined" thingy from the description.

That would leave the 4 against Yoda, Vader, and Maul.

Surik would beat Maul pretty phenomenally, given its her just after beating Traya. Revan would stalemate with Vader, while Dooku and HOT give Yoda an extremely close contest.

What would give the team the win is the force bonds from Surik, and the battle precognition of Revan. They work extremely well in team fights.

The fastest fight to finish would be Maul and Surik, in her favor. That allows her to pretty easily take Vader with Revan.

Given the death of the two Sith that Windu would be feeding on, the Vapaad amp would probably falter, meaning he'd need Surik and Revan's help. I don't think Sidious would beat a team like that, and even Yoda can't beat a Tyranus/HOT combo....

So Yeh, the team beats round 3 and by extension round 4. Loses to 5 though.
